We recently did an attic blow-in insulation project to a home that had no insulation in the attic. The owner was paying almost $300 a month in her electric bill. After they filled the attic with fiberglass insulation she was paying only $150 a month. She recuperated the investment on the insulation in less than a year.

What questions should customers think through before talking to pros about their needs?
The brand that you want is very important. Many think of Carrier and Trane because those are famous names, but what I always recommend is to check, how many suppliers for that brand are in your area. These days, the units are not like they were 10 or 15 years ago. They all have faults and will have at least 1 break in the first 10 years of life. When that happens, you want to make that the part you need under warranty, will be available as soon as possible, and you get that with suppliers that have more stores in your area.
